2009 Audi A8 vs. 1993 Nissan Serena
To start off, 2009 Audi A8 is newer by 16 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 1993 Nissan Serena.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 1993 Nissan Serena would be higher. At 4,163 cc (8 cylinders), 2009 Audi A8 is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 2009 Audi A8 (350 HP @ 6800 RPM) has 226 more horse power than 1993 Nissan Serena. (124 HP @ 6000 RPM). In normal driving conditions, 2009 Audi A8 should accelerate faster than 1993 Nissan Serena.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 1993 Nissan Serena weights approximately 336 kg more than 2009 Audi A8.
Let's talk about torque, 2009 Audi A8 (441 Nm @ 3500 RPM) has 272 more torque (in Nm) than 1993 Nissan Serena. (169 Nm @ 4800 RPM). This means 2009 Audi A8 will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 1993 Nissan Serena.
